A Sleek All-Day Restaurant Joins Palm Springs’s Hot Dining Scene - Eater LA
"A sleek new desert restaurant has opened over the weekend. It’s called AC3, and should fit in nicely with the weekend and Coachella crowds. Located along Larkspur Lane in Palm Desert, AC3 is a collaboration between Andrew and Juliana Copley (Copley’s) and Tony Marchese (TRIO), situated adjacent to the Hotel Paseo. Expect casual new American fare like sea bass with black lentils and braised beef short rib, presented in a comfortable, design-forward setting. AC3 is open for dinner only to start, with daily breakfast and lunch to come soon." - Farley Elliott
